Output 89d5bce566ae2f13218ddc592333647362c249ced19735a89e5345cea34ebd99:3

value
15746831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adff40e029301588581fc139c5d468d2c3b8c835 OP_EQUAL
address
MPmAuwD1r1gz95ymCenKhs8hsWJY94JpMW
transaction
89d5bce566ae2f13218ddc592333647362c249ced19735a89e5345cea34ebd99
spent
true